Regular Season Round 2: Residence - Musel Pikes 56-63
Date: October 12, 2013
The game in Bereldange was also worth to mention about. Musel Pikes (2-0) played at the court of Residence (0-2). Musel Pikes managed to secure a 7-point victory 63-56. It looked good early as Residence took an 2-point lead at the end of first quarter. But then Musel Pikes had a 15-11 second period charge getting the lead and Residence was not able to take back game control losing it eventually 56-63. Musel Pikes dominated on the defensive end, holding Residence to just 6 points in third quarter. The game was dominated by American players. Forward Toney McCray (198-89, college: Nebraska, agency: Interperformances) orchestrated the victory with a double-double by scoring 22 points and 11 rebounds. Forward Trenton Wurtz (203-83, college: Indiana St.) contributed with a double-double by scoring 14 points and 13 rebounds for the winners. Power forward Dustin Scott (203-85, college: Charleston) replied with a double-double by scoring 13 points and 13 rebounds and power forward Anthony Simpson (203-87, college: Kent St., agency: Pro Partner Sports Management) added 14 points and 9 rebounds in the effort for Residence. Four Residence players scored in double figures. Musel Pikes will play against Contern (#5) in Luxembourg in the next round. Residence will play on the road against Heffingen and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
Top scorers:
Musel Pikes: T.McCray 22+11reb+1ast, T.Wurtz 14+13reb+1ast, J.Kox 11+2reb, T.Welter 6+1reb+1ast, G.Schmit 6+1ast, C.Donnersbach 2+1reb+1ast
Residence: A.Simpson 14+9reb+1ast, D.Scott 13+13reb+1ast, P.Koster 12+2reb+4ast, J.Biever 10+1reb+1ast, M.Schmit 7+1reb+1ast, I.Tomas 0+1reb+1ast
